Solution for (3x+6)=(2x+19) equation:



(3x+6)=(2x+19)
We move all terms to the left:
(3x+6)-((2x+19))=0
We get rid of parentheses
3x-((2x+19))+6=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-((2x+19)), so:
(2x+19)
We get rid of parentheses
2x+19
Back to the equation:
-(2x+19)
We get rid of parentheses
3x-2x-19+6=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
x-13=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
x=13
